Useless because:
Shadowbind is worthless using in the middle of combat, the most advantage of that skill is binding the target, so that you can run. If you hit the target, they get released.
Also, it consumes a lot of stamina, you won't use it too much later on. Or will use it just to bind and get some distance from the target.
Final Note: you can put /recast "Skill Name", so that when you use a macro, it'll write up the cooldown remaining to be able to use that skill again.
Ex:
/ac "Wide Volley II" <t>
/wait 3
/recast "Wide Volley II"
